一名昆士兰州法官以公共安全风险为由,拒绝保释Craig Rackley,他被控在2025年的泊车纠纷期间发动了一次托马霍克式袭击。
A Queensland judge denied bail to Craig Rackley, accused of a 2025 tomahawk attack during a parking dispute, citing public safety risks.
A Brisbane最高法院法官拒绝为57岁的Craig Andrew Rackley提供保释,此人被控在昆士兰州洛根莱亚发生2025年9月的托马霍克攻击事件,当时发生关于灯光和停车的轻微争端。
A Brisbane Supreme Court judge denied bail to 57-year-old Craig Andrew Rackley, accused of a September 2025 tomahawk attack in Loganlea, Queensland, during a minor dispute over lights and parking.
受害者是一名52岁的妇女,有复合手臂骨折,一名40岁的男子头骨骨折,在法官裁定Rackley尽管没有犯罪记录,但仍对公共安全构成威胁后,他们表示宽慰。
The victims, a 52-year-old woman with a compound arm fracture and a 40-year-old man with skull fractures, expressed relief after the judge ruled Rackley posed a danger to public safety despite no prior criminal record.
视频证据显示Rackley大喊威胁并攻击受害者。
Video evidence showed Rackley shouting threats and attacking the victims.
援引醉酒和个人损失的辩护论点被驳回,要求距离和监测的拟议保释计划也遭到拒绝。
Defense arguments citing intoxication and personal losses were rejected, as was a proposed bail plan requiring distance and monitoring.
Rackley面临两项旨在造成严重身体伤害的行为。
Rackley faces two counts of acts intended to cause grievous bodily harm.
